JsHtaFramework 已经正式命名为 jsapp
项目URL不变:http://code.google.com/p/jshtaframework/
下载地址:http://code.google.com/p/jshtaframework/downloads/list
JavaScript应用框架,前者的名字是jshtaframework。
现在我们称为:JSAPP或JSAPP 6月5日,2009年
这个项目开始于2006年10月16日
我们计划来支持以下功能:
支持云计算…
支持OR-Mapping…支持模板…
这是个Javascript框架,有点像Java
和例外了(见Exception_improvement)
扩展和实施的支持(见Extend_Implement_usage)
支持远程操作
支持过载
支持检查争论
支持齿轮很长的名单中有大图存储于数据库利用齿轮)
支持OR-Mapping齿轮简单
jsapp项目组的宗旨:
构建基于html(js)很容易的应用。
该框架应该浏览器兼容的。
用这个框架你能编码这样的:
/*
* cn.aprilsoft.jsapp.text.StringMaker.js
* jsapp, String maker functions
*
* Copyright(C) Hatter Jiang
*/
// New package: cn.aprilsoft.jsapp.text.StringMaker
Package("cn.aprilsoft.jsapp.text.StringMaker");
Class("cn.aprilsoft.jsapp.text.StringMaker", Extend(), Implement(),
{
_stringbuffer: [],
Constructor: function(str)
{
this._stringbuffer = [];
if (typeof(str) != "undefined")
{
this._stringbuffer.push(str);
}
},
append: function()
{
for (var i = 0; i < arguments.length; i++)
{
var tmpstr = "";
if (arguments[i] != null)
{
tmpstr = arguments[i].toString();
}
this._stringbuffer.push(tmpstr);
}
return this;
},
getString: function()
{
return this._stringbuffer.join("");
}
});
代码来自:cn.aprilsoft.jsapp.text.StringMaker
下边来看一下案例:
作为JsEditorHelper工具箱的第一个工具ColorPicker现在发布,ColorPicker主要用于Web设计人员用于调配颜色。
目前软件版本:1.00.000 alpha1 build 070427
JsHtaFramework版本:1.00.000 alpha1 build 070426
软件界面截图:
软件下载:
ColorPicker.v.1.00.000alpha1b070427.zip
本文相关标签:
JScript, JavaScript, EcmaScript,Ecma3, Ecma262, HTA,HTMLApplication, HTML, DHTML,AJAX, DevTool, Utility, FrameWork,Library, jsapp